Well, I'm sorry to say that I don't see any errors in that log file. I'm wondering if that really corresponds to when X11 locked up. In ubuntu you can see the time stamp on the log file (last time it was written to or modified), by using the -l option with ls. For example:
Code:
ls -l /var/log/Xorg.0.log
If there is an error about permissions, use sudo. Ie
Code:
sudo ls -l /var/log/Xorg.0.log
You can look for other related logfiles with the following command
Code:
ls -l /var/log/Xorg*.log*
Basically you need to try to find one that corresponds to when there was a problem. An easy way to do this may be to restart X and wait for it to bork. However, the "correct" way to restart X will depend on what release of Ubuntu you are using. From some of the dates reported in the log file you appear to be running 12.04. A quick search indicates that 12.04 uses lightdm as the display manager, so you should be able to restart X11 with the following command:
Code:
sudo service lightdm restart
Hopefully with this/these procedures we can get a log file that contains the error that causes the X11 problem.

Scrape away the gui and the installation of non-free software etc. and Ubuntu and Mint are pretty much the same thing (notice the references to Ubuntu in Xorg.0.log). Everything I wrote, except possibly what display manager is being used still applies.
